yourEra

What we like

  • Publishes its real prices on the site — a genuine plus when many compounded competitors hide cost behind a quiz
  • Carries both compounded semaglutide and tirzepatide, not a single molecule
  • Broad menu beyond GLP-1 — NAD+, microdosing protocols, and an optional coaching/nutritionist/at-home-labs bundle
  • Markets a 50-state licensed-clinician network with no insurance required; HSA/FSA accepted

The caveats

  • Compounded semaglutide and tirzepatide are not FDA-approved and can tighten as brand shortages resolve — not the same as Wegovy, Ozempic or Zepbound
  • Mid-market pricing sits above the cheapest compounders, which start closer to $99–$150
  • Injectable-only — no FDA-approved brand-name lane and no oral route
  • Thin independent footprint with few third-party reviews; the 50-state and efficacy claims are self-reported

Ondra Health

What we like

  • Among the lowest disclosed compounded-semaglutide prices anywhere
  • LegitScript-certified with brand-name access on top of compounded
  • Available in all 50 states

The caveats

  • Tirzepatide is priced higher than its standout semaglutide
  • Newer name with a thinner public track record
